About This Item
New York: Dodd, Mead & Co, 1885. Book. Fair. Cloth. 16mo - over 5¾" - 6¾" tall. Yellow cloth binding. The pages are in good condition with a very few light scattered soil spots. There is a to, from printed in pencil on the front end paper. The book is rated fair because the front cover has lots of soil spotting. The spine and back cover have a few small soil spots..
